Transcript: Are we certified? Yes, we are ASE-Certified which is the national standard for technicians. Not only is it a test and course that we have to take and pass, we have to recertify every 5 years so that way when you bring your vehicle in, you can be confident that we are up to date on all of the interworkings of your vehicle.

At SubieSmith, our technicians are ASE-Certified, which is the national standard for automotive technicians. This certification requires passing rigorous tests and courses. Additionally, our technicians must recertify every 5 years. This ensures that when you bring your vehicle to us, you can be confident that our team is knowledgeable and up to date on all the intricacies of your vehicle.

At SubieSmith, we prioritize safety and transparency in our repair process.

We use a green, yellow, and red system during inspections to categorize the urgency of repairs. Green indicates minor issues that don’t require immediate attention, yellow represents moderate issues that will need to be addressed in the near future, and red signifies severe problems that need immediate attention for safety reasons.

We understand that not all repairs need to be done right away, so we help you differentiate between what is urgent and what can wait until your schedule and budget allow. We never proceed with any repairs without your expressed consent. Whether it’s spending 45 minutes on the phone explaining the process or walking you through the repairs in person, we are committed to ensuring you understand the repairs needed and why they are necessary.

All our pricing is package pricing, which includes parts, labor, taxes, and fees. This means that the price we quote you is the price you pay, with no hidden fees or surprises. Additionally, we save your old parts as proof and to explain what was wrong and why it needed to be replaced.

When you bring your vehicle to SubieSmith, you can be confident that you’ll receive an honest assessment of your vehicle’s condition and a transparent repair process.
